If you’re exploring the heart of Transylvania and want a meaningful, up-close look at rescued bears, this tour to Libearty Bear Sanctuary offers a chance to see the incredible work being done to protect Romania’s brown bears. For $93 per person, you’ll enjoy a roundtrip transfer from Brasov, a guided tour of Europe’s largest bear sanctuary in Zarnesti, and a chance to learn firsthand about these majestic animals. The entire experience lasts around four hours, making it perfect for a half-day adventure.

What we love about this experience is how it combines comfortable transportation with a heartfelt guided walk through the forest paths, giving you not just a sightseeing moment but a connection to the bears’ stories. The sanctuary itself is expansive, covering 60 hectares, and hosts over 110 rescued bears — a real testament to Romania’s commitment to animal welfare.

The Sanctuary’s Mission and Why It Matters

Once you arrive at Libearty in Zarnesti, you’ll meet a guide from the sanctuary who will lead you inside. The sanctuary is not a zoo; it’s a vast, natural habitat where rescued bears live free from captivity. The guides are passionate and knowledgeable, sharing heartfelt stories about each bear — how they came to the sanctuary, their individual personalities, and the ongoing efforts to give them a second chance.

Walking Through Nature: Forest Paths and Bear Tales

The main activity involves a one-hour guided walk along a forest trail about 2 km long. During this gentle stroll, you’ll hear the bears’ stories, learn about their rescue, and understand the sanctuary’s role in wildlife rehabilitation. The atmosphere is peaceful, with the sounds of birds and rustling leaves, which makes for a truly immersive experience.

What the Bears Want You to Know

The sanctuary emphasizes the importance of respecting the bears’ environment. Visitors are asked to switch off mobiles, avoid flashes and loud noises, and refrain from feeding or drinking in front of the bears. These rules are vital for the animals’ well-being, and generally, visitors comply happily — after all, who wants to be the noisy visitor in a peaceful forest?

Practical Considerations and Visitor Tips

Children under five are not allowed inside for safety reasons, which is understandable given the size and strength of the bears. The tour is accessible to most adults and older children, but keep in mind the walking distance and the rules about noise and disturbance.

The Cost and What You’re Getting

For $93, you get transportation, entrance fees (if you select that option), and a guided experience. While the price might seem steep for a half-day, you’re paying for ethical conservation, expert guidance, and a meaningful encounter with wildlife. Some reviews mention the fee for photography — 50 lei for cameras — but phone photos are free, which is good to know if you want to capture the moment without extra costs.

Is transportation included in the tour?
Yes, a fully insured, climate-controlled sedan or minivan with fuel, parking fees, and taxes is provided for the roundtrip transfer from Brasov.

How long does the tour last?
The entire experience, including transportation and the guided walk, takes around four hours.

Are children allowed on this tour?
Children under five years are not permitted inside the sanctuary, primarily for safety reasons.

Do I need to pay for photos?
If you want to take photos with a camera, there is an extra fee of 50 lei. Phone photos can be taken free of charge.

What should I bring?
Comfortable shoes are recommended as you’ll be walking about 2 km along forest paths.

Can the group be very large?
While advertised as a small-group experience, some reviews mention groups of up to 40 people, which might make hearing the guide more difficult.
